Elevate, City, Amaze and More Help Honda Cars India Post 13% YoY Sales Growth in September

Honda Cars India has revealed its sales data for September 2023. In the last month, the automaker reported selling 9,861 units in the domestic market. Let's take a closer look at the sales figures for the previous month.

Honda Cars India is basking in the glory of positive sales last month. In September 2023, the company reported monthly domestic sales of 9,861 vehicles, a 13% increase over the same month the previous year. In terms of export, the manufacturer reported dispatching 1,310 units in September 2023, a decline from the 2,333 units shipped in the same time in 2022. On a month-to-month basis, these export figures for the previous month are also less than the 2,189 units exported in August 2023.

While sharing the previous month's sales performance, the carmaker indicated that the introduction of the all-new Honda Elevate assisted the firm in maintaining its sales momentum. This brand-new SUV has risen as a frontrunner and is anticipated to contribute considerably to sales in the ongoing festive period. The Honda City and the Amaze are among the other best-performing vehicles for the month.

Honda Elevate SUV Surpassed 200 Units Sales Milestone in a Single Day

Honda Cars India recently completed the delivery of 200 units of the Elevate in a single day.  On September 4, the carmaker began customer deliveries of the mid-size SUV. It delivered 100 SUVs in a single day during an event in Hyderabad on September 10. And recently, at an event in Chennai, Tamil Nadu, India, the firm hit another big milestone for its new SUV, the Elevate, by dispatching 200 units in a single day. The Elevate SUV starts at Rs 11 lakh for the base SV MT model and goes up to Rs 16 lakh for the top-spec ZX CVT model. All are ex-showroom prices. 

Honda Elevate: Engine and Dimensions

The Elevate comes equipped with a single 1.5-litre iVTEC petrol engine that churns out 120bhp and 145Nm of performance figures. The available transmission options include a 6-speed manual and a 7-speed CVT. The mid-size SUV by Honda is accessible in four versions– SV, V, VX, and ZX. The 6-speed manual transmission comes standard on all 4 versions, while the 7-speed CVT gearbox is available on the V, VX, and ZX variants.

The all-new Honda SUV is 1,790mm in width, 1,650mm in height, and 4,312mm in length. Additionally, it has a segment-leading cargo space of 458 litres.
